1. How Do I Link My Bank Account to PayPal?
Linking your bank account to your PayPal account is a straightforward process. To add your bank account to your PayPal wallet, navigate to your PayPal wallet, select “Add a card or bank account,” then “Add a bank account” and enter your bank details. You will need your bank’s sort code and account number. Confirm the details and click ‘Agree and add’ to complete the process. According to PayPal’s official website, linking your bank account allows for easy transfers and payments.

2. What Are The Steps To Transfer Money From PayPal To My Bank Account Online?
Transferring money from PayPal to your bank account online involves a few simple steps. First, go to your PayPal Wallet and click ‘Transfer Money’. Then, choose the ‘Transfer to your Bank’ option, select the appropriate bank account, and click ‘Continue’. Next, enter the amount you wish to transfer and click ‘Next’, before confirming everything is correct and clicking ‘Transfer Now’. This will initiate the transfer of funds to your bank account.

4. How Long Does It Take To Transfer Money From PayPal To My Bank Account?
The time it takes to transfer money from PayPal to your bank account typically ranges from one to five business days. According to PayPal’s Help Center, most transfers are completed within one business day. However, depending on the bank, it can sometimes take up to five business days for the funds to appear in your account. If there are any issues with the transfer, it may take up to a week for the bank to notify PayPal, and the money will then be returned to your account.

5. Is It Possible To Transfer Money From PayPal To My Bank Account Instantly?
Yes, it is possible to transfer money from PayPal to your bank account instantly, but there are certain conditions. PayPal offers an Instant Transfer option that allows you to transfer money to your bank account in just minutes. However, this service is only available for eligible debit cards or bank accounts and comes with a fee of 1.50%, with a maximum fee of $15.

6. Why Can’t I Transfer PayPal Money To My Bank?
There are several reasons why you might be unable to transfer PayPal money to your bank account. Common issues include unusual activity detected on your account, an ineligible bank account or debit card for instant transfers, incorrect bank information, or a limitation on your PayPal account. In such cases, you may need to confirm your identity, update your bank information, or resolve any limitations through PayPal’s Resolution Center.

7. What Are The Fees For Transferring Money From PayPal To My Bank?
While PayPal doesn’t always charge direct fees for transferring money to your bank, various fees may apply. These can include electronic fund transfer fees charged by your bank, withdrawal fees, and currency conversion fees for international transfers. It’s essential to check with your bank and PayPal’s fee structure to understand any potential costs associated with the transfer.

9. What Banks Are Eligible For PayPal’s Instant Transfer?
PayPal’s Instant Transfer service is available for several major banks. These include Bank of America, BNY Mellon, BB&T, Citibank, JPMorgan Chase, Keybank, PNC, SunTrust, and Wells Fargo. If you bank with one of these institutions, you may be eligible for instant transfers, provided your account meets PayPal’s other eligibility criteria.

10. How Does Wise Compare To PayPal For International Transfers?
Wise (formerly TransferWise) often provides more cost-effective and transparent international transfer options compared to PayPal. Wise typically offers exchange rates closer to the mid-market rate, with clear, upfront fees. In contrast, PayPal’s international transfer fees can be higher due to currency conversion fees and other charges. Comparing both services for your specific transfer needs can help you make an informed decision.
